What is this device?

This is the USB identifier for a Dynax 5D camera manufactured by Konica Minolta. The vendor ID 132b is registered to Konica Minolta with the USB Implementers Forum, and 002c is the product ID that Konica Minolta assigned to this particular model. When you run lsusb on Linux, this device appears as 132b:002c Konica Minolta Dynax 5D camera.

How to identify it on your system

Linux

$ lsusb
Bus 001 Device 004: ID 132b:002c Konica Minolta Dynax 5D camera

You can filter directly with lsusb -d 132b:002c, or get the full descriptor dump with lsusb -v -d 132b:002c. Kernel messages from dmesg show the same pair as idVendor=132b, idProduct=002c.

Windows

In Device Manager, open the device, go to Details → Hardware Ids. This device reports:

USB\VID_132B&PID_002C
USB\VID_132B&PID_002C&REV_0100

From PowerShell: Get-PnpDevice | Where-Object InstanceId -match "VID_132B&PID_002C"

macOS

$ system_profiler SPUSBDataType
    Dynax 5D camera:
      Product ID: 0x002c
      Vendor ID: 0x132b  (Konica Minolta)
